​UNDERGRADUATE & M.S. STUDENT RESEARCH INVOLVEMENT

  • Our group has an active program of undergraduate and M.S. student research involvement during the semester and summer and we also participate in the School's Undergraduate Reseach Involvement Program (URIP).

  • Self-driven, highly motivated candidates for projects for credit can contact Prof. Kinget. Before emailing, go carefully through this website. Please make sure your email includes details on your education (resume, grades, ...), on your motivation for doing a research project and on your prior research or design experience (copies of papers, reports, ...). Start the subject of your email with "[Student Interested in a Research Project]".

IEEE-MTT Fellowships

  • The IEEE Microwave Theory and Techniques Society offers undergraduate fellowships for senior undergraduate students who want to do a research project. Details can be found from the society's homepage www.mtt.org -> Awards -> Undergraduate Scholarships. Contact Prof. Kinget if you are interested to apply.
